A common representation of manufacturing planning and control in CIM systems is in the form of a hierarchy of controllers. An important issue in terms of data management and communication in such systems is the quantity and quality of information exchanged between the controllers. Just as in an organizational hierarchy, the span of control of each decisionmaker or controller has considerable influence on the quantity and quality of information exchanged. In this study, we determine the optimal span of control based on quantitative factors that shape the multilevel coordination in the CIM hierarchy. The control scope in the study is limited to the bottom two levels of such a hierarchical chain of control, namely, the workstation controller and the automation module (or device controller). These two levels are responsible for executing the production plans and schedules developed in the upper levels of the CIM hierarchy.
